The equal opportunity officer is responsible for the development and coordination of the Department’s equal opportunity and affirmative action programs and for the development and implementation of the Department’s civil rights compliance monitoring and technical assistance programs. These responsibilities entail coordination with department units as well as the regional workforce boards to ensure compliance with the nondiscrimination regulations applicable to recipients of federal financial assistance. This responsibility extends to all areas: application for employment; application for programs and services; and program participation and service delivery. Some out-of-town travel may be necessary. The equal opportunity officer is accountable for the fulfillment of equal-opportunity requirements and achievement of employment objectives established by the Department in compliance with federal and state laws and implementing regulations. The equal opportunity officer is also responsible for ensuring that appropriate training opportunities are available to Department staff, at all grade levels and in all occupational areas, on a nondiscriminatory basis and that civil rights program-related training is an integral part of the Department and other recipient programs. Pay $83,000 – $90,000 Annually Your Specific Responsibilities Oversee the development and implementation of the state’s Methods of Administration under 29CFR part 37. Manage the civil rights compliance program for the Department, coordinate and participate in all phases of the review of programs receiving federal financial assistance from or through the Department. Perform desk reviews of service-delivery data and locally developed policies to ensure compliance with applicable regulations; conduct site reviews; prepare reports of review; review corrective-action plans and develop and review conciliation agreements. Develop and deliver or arrange for civil rights program training for Department and other recipient management and staff. Provide technical assistance as necessary. Develop and coordinate implementation of guidelines for filing complaints of discrimination and the procedures for alternative dispute resolution. Conduct or coordinate investigation of discrimination complaints; prepare and review reports of investigation; arrange for and review and monitor the results of mediation of discrimination complaints. Develop, coordinate, and monitor implementation of the Department’s affirmative-action plan. Prepare and disseminate routine and special reports required under applicable federal and state regulations; prepare activities reports and trends analyses. Serve as the Department’s principal liaison with federal, state, and local agencies and organizations regarding civil rights program related issues. Serve as the Department’s principal contact person on program and facility-accessibility issues under federal and state accessibility guidelines. Review proposed civil rights program-related legislation and regulations. Perform other legal duties as assigned by the General Counsel.
